  • Abstract
    Today´s manufacturing and building operations are faced with the need to reduce cost and be more competitive with the fewest of resources. Connectivity to different infrastructures for data gathering and the need to analyze and visualize data in real time is ever more important in today´s economic environment. Recently, visualization systems have taken a giant step forward incorporating advanced hardware accelerated 3D graphics into standard off-the commercial product. As a result, providing compelling 3D graphics applications and having access to plant data is the key to having a competitive advantage. This paper presents a whole new powerful approach to visualization of manufacturing that greatly reduces the learning curve for developing Human Machine Interface (HMI) applications.
